Description
Cheesy Taco Sticks are a delicious and easy-to-make snack that combines the flavors of tacos with cheesy goodness, perfect for parties or a quick meal.
Ingredients
Scale
- 1 lb (450 g) ground beef (or turkey)
- 1 packet taco seasoning + ⅓ cup water
- ½ cup salsa
- 1 tube refrigerated pizza dough (or crescent roll sheet)
- 2 cups shredded cheese (cheddar, Mexican blend, or mozzarella)
- 1 egg (beaten, for egg wash)
- Optional: sour cream, guacamole, or extra salsa for dipping
Instructions
- In a skillet, cook ground beef over medium heat until browned. Drain excess fat. Stir in taco seasoning and water. Simmer until thickened, about 3–4 minutes. Stir in salsa and let cool slightly.
- Preheat oven to 425°F (220°C). Roll out pizza dough on a lightly floured surface into a rectangle. Cut into 8 equal sections.
- Place a spoonful of taco mixture in the center of each dough section. Sprinkle generously with shredded cheese. Fold dough over filling, pinching seams tightly to seal (like a breadstick shape).
- Arrange on a parchment-lined baking sheet. Brush tops with beaten egg. Sprinkle extra cheese on top, if desired. Bake for 12–15 minutes, or until golden brown and cheese is melted.
- Let cool slightly before serving. Enjoy with sour cream, guacamole, or extra salsa for dipping.
Notes
- For a spicier kick, add jalapeños to the meat mixture.
- These can be made ahead of time and frozen before baking.
- Experiment with different types of cheese for varied flavors.
